ALEXANDRIA, Va., Feb. 24 -- United States Patent no. 12,563,385, issued on Feb. 24, was assigned to Schreder S.A. (Brussels).

"Rotating coordinator in mesh network" was invented by Robert Link (Ratingen, Germany), Udayteja Davuluru (Dusseldorf, Germany) and Daniel Brand (Wedemark, Germany).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"Example embodiments relate to rotating coordinators in mesh networks. One example mesh network includes multiple communication devices adapted to communicate in the mesh network according to a predetermined protocol.
